Convert from type X to type Y
integer to String :
int i = 42; String str = Integer.toString(i);or String str = "" + i |
String str = Double.toString(i); |
String str = Long.toString(l); |
String str = Float.toString(f); |
String to integer :
str = "25"; int i = Integer.valueOf(str).intValue();or int i = Integer.parseInt(str); |
double d = Double.valueOf(str).doubleValue(); |
long l = Long.valueOf(str).longValue();or long l = Long.parseLong(str); |
float f = Float.valueOf(str).floatValue(); |
decimal to binary :
int i = 42; String binstr = Integer.toBinaryString(i); |
decimal to hexadecimal :
int i = 42; String hexstr = Integer.toString(i, 16);or String hexstr = Integer.toHexString(i);or (with leading zeroes and uppercase) public class Hex {
public static void main(String args[]){
int i = 42;
System.out.print
(Integer.toHexString( 0x10000 | i).substring(1).toUpperCase());
}
}
|
hexadecimal (String) to integer :
int i = Integer.valueOf("B8DA3", 16).intValue();
orint i = Integer.parseInt("B8DA3", 16); |
ASCII code to String
int i = 64; String aChar = new Character((char)i).toString(); |
integer to ASCII code (byte)
char c = 'A'; int i = (int) c; // i will have the value 65 decimal |
To extract Ascii codes from a String
String test = "ABCD";
for ( int i = 0; i < test.length(); ++i ) {
char c = test.charAt( i );
int j = (int) c;
System.out.println(j);
} |

note :To catch illegal number conversion, try using the try/catch mechanism.
try{
i = Integer.parseInt(aString);
}
catch(NumberFormatException e)
{
}
